Transaction 74cbb3589a778625deb97e7ddae347fcbc3ce3b8238f25e72f7e686deabcfcfd
1 Input
1 Output
-
74cbb3589a778625deb97e7ddae347fcbc3ce3b8238f25e72f7e686deabcfcfd:0
- value
- 62770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78715e403ff45eb5e0246d85d9678fa7b64919f0 OP_EQUAL
- address
- 3CfrpXDbBi76hVT8EaBYLrskh7hYrxbYVX